Since her levels are a bit off, did the Dr. reccomend putting her on Lactulose? It's a sugury solution that helps eliminate the toxins through her poop.

My Dolce had LS, diagnoised at 6 1/2 months. She did the shunt surgery and is doing great now.

I also fed Dolce a high fiber content diet to help eliminate toxins (oatmeal, sweet pot, yams, lentils, quinox). Also give her bits of watermelon, that helps too, but I forgot how. Eggs, cottage cheese were a great staple in her diet to provide the right protien. No Bully sticks if you give her those. They're high in protien too. I'll look up recipes to send you.

Also if you're going to put her on a prescription diet, give her the brand Royal Canin and not Hills. Hills contains an additive (it's starts with an "E", sorry I forgot the name, but the Yahoo group has articles in the archives about it) that is proven to be bad for LS.
